the story:
Phil DeGuere was a TV producer most noted for the '80's TV show "Simon and Simon". During the '80's he set out to make a film that was to be entitled "Armageddon Rag." This was to have been produced from the novel of the same name by George R.R. Martin, but was never completed. In the book, the title song "Armageddon Rag" is played by a band called "The Nazgûl." DeGuere was a friend of the Grateful Dead and he put together this ficticious rock band "The Nazgûl" to appear in the movie and do the sound track. The project was scrapped but here is the music in beautiful sound quality. All Cip fans will love this.
